Viewsonic has announced the V38r-06, V38r-07 and V38r-07a rugged handheld computers, which are designed and built to meet mobile computing demands across a variety of industries, including retail, public safety, healthcare and military. To keep in mind compatability issues the units run on older Windows Mobile 2003 and are powered by Intel XScale processors. The devices meet IP54 design standards for sealing against dust, moisture and extreme environmental conditions and offer secure data exchange with 802.11b/g. Common features include 3.5-inch 240 x 320 (QVGA) LCD display, 520MHZ Intel Xscale processor, Jog dial, SD card slot and hot swappable Lithium Ion batteries which allow battery changes without shutdown or loss of data. The V38r-07/-07a (pictured) is the premier model in the V38r Series and is packed with 802.11b/g wireless, Bluetooth, bar code scanner, 1.3 megapixel camera, fingerprint sensor and GPS (Global Positioning System) support. The V38r-07a is Trade Agreement Act (TAA) compliant to support government sales.
The V38r-06 on the other hand combines data communications and bar code scanning capabilities in one simple package by integrating 802.11b/g wireless, Bluetooth, bar code scanner and a secure digital (SD) card slot. Retail pricing of the V38r-07, V38r-07a and V38r-06 is $1,899, $ 1,999 and $1,599 respectively.
